ICAR-IIWM Recruitment 2025: Overview and Important Details

Organization and Posts

The Indian Institute of Water Management (ICAR-IIWM), Bhubaneswar, is inviting qualified candidates for the following positions:

Post Title No. of Vacancies Place of Posting Salary (Consolidated) Qualification Age Limit
Young Professional-II 1 Bhubaneswar, Odisha ₹42,000/- per month M.Tech/M.E (CSE/IT) 21-45 years
Field Assistant 1 Daspalla, Nayagarh, Odisha ₹15,000/- per month B.Sc/Diploma in Agriculture Men: up to 35 years; Women: up to 40 years

Key Dates and Venue

The recruitment process involves a walk-in interview scheduled as follows:

  • Interview Date: 25th November 2025
  • Reporting Time for Document Verification: 9:30 AM
  • Last Entry Allowed: 11:00 AM

The interview will be held at:

Venue: ICAR-Indian Institute of Water Management, Opp. Rail Vihar, Chandrasekharpur, Bhubaneswar-751023, Odisha

Eligibility Criteria and Qualifications

Educational Qualifications

Post Required Qualification
Young Professional-II M.Tech/M.E in Computer Science Engineering (CSE) or Information Technology (IT)
Field Assistant B.Sc in Agriculture or Diploma in Agriculture-related fields

Experience and Desirable Skills

While the basic educational qualification is essential, desirable experience for the Young Professional-II post includes knowledge of computer programming. Such familiarity can be advantageous during the selection process.

Age Limits and Relaxation

The age limits are as follows:

  • Young Professional-II: 21 to 45 years
  • Field Assistant: Men up to 35 years, Women up to 40 years

For candidates belonging to SC/ST/OBC categories, age relaxation will be provided as per Government of India norms and ICAR guidelines.

Remuneration and Contract Details

This engagement is temporary and purely contractual, valid up to 31st March 2026 or earlier, based on project requirements. Candidates will not have claims for permanent absorption or regular appointment in ICAR after completion of the contract period.

Post Monthly Salary Allowances
Young Professional-II ₹42,000/- Consolidated; no other allowances
Field Assistant ₹15,000/- Consolidated; no other allowances
